The ingredients needed to cook Chicken baked with Phyllo & Feta Cheese (Kotopita):

  1. Use 500 grams of Chicken boiled & shredded.
  2. Provide 2 of medium size Eggs.
  3. Get 1/2 cup of Feta Cheese.
  4. Use 6 sheets of Phyllo Dough.
  5. Prepare of Olive Oil.

Instructions to make Chicken baked with Phyllo & Feta Cheese (Kotopita):

  1. Chop and boil chicken..
  2. When the boiled chicken has cooled off shred with a fork..
  3. Slightly beat 2 eggs before adding into the chicken..
  4. Toss into the shredded chicken the cheese and eggs and a pinch of salt..
  5. Brush baking pan with olive oil and start to slowly layer the 3 sheets of Phyllo..
  6. Add in the chicken mixture..
  7. Layer the last 3 sheets of phyllo on top of the chicken mixture and brush each sheet with olive oil..
